We are looking for a senior New Store OMS Developer to join our team and take ownership of a critical middleware integration connecting New Store OMS/POS with Shopify. You will be responsible for auditing an existing middleware layer, stabilizing it, and evolving it from reactive bug fixing into a scalable, feature-driven integration.
The ideal candidate brings direct, hands‑on New Store OMS integration experience and can ramp up quickly on an inherited codebase with minimal guidance.
Please Note: This is a Contract position (hourly rate). We welcome applications from across the globe, but our preferred candidates should be able to work in Eastern Standard Timezone (EST). Responsibilities: • Lead audit/discovery of an existing Newstore OMS ↔ Shopify integration and middleware (architecture, data flows, failure modes). • Take full ownership of middleware maintenance, shifting focus from reactive bug fixing to proactive feature delivery • Develop, test, and deploy enhancements to the OMS–Shopify integration layer • Troubleshoot and resolve integration issues between New Store OMS and Shopify •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(engineers, delivery managers, stakeholders) to clarify requirements, prioritize fixes, and ship improvements. • Provide technical input on platform integration decisions and evolving requirements • Participate in code reviews and contribute to continuous improvement of integration practices • Document integration logic, data flows, and system changes throughout the engagement
Requirements: • Hands-on experience integrating Newstore , ideally with a focus on Newstore OMS • Senior-level experience owning production integrations and debugging complex systems under real-world constraints. • Proven ability to perform technical audits and ramp quickly in partially documented or “black box” environments. • Strong API/integration fundamentals (REST, webhooks/event-driven patterns, async processing, data consistency, reconciliation workflows). • Strong software engineering fundamentals (system design, data modeling, testing strategies). • Strong written and verbal communication skills for async, cross-functional collaboration • Ability to work with meaningful overlap in Eastern Time (ET/EST) hours.
